Dominic wrote:
[As I understand it from reading the section in man, the purpose of the '--include' option (and related options) is to re-include files that have been excluded by an '--exclude' option (and related options) appearing later on the command line (later because the options are processed in reverse order). You cannot include files or directories with an '--include' option that are not in the original source directory.]
